Quote:
Originally Posted by introzen
Would it be better to send one query and use the loop to store data in the array like this?
|
Yes. I praise you for finding this out yourself. Got a tutorial in my sig (don't know which one) that's on this topic, as well.
Quote:
Originally Posted by AndySedeyn
PHP код:
for(new i = 0, j = cache_get_row_count(); i != j; i ++) if(i < MAX_BUILDINGS) {
|
Unrelated, but pro tip: you can put multiple conditions in the loop header itself. If the condition isn't met the loop stops. Whereas with a nested if the loop keeps on running until it's done, even if there's no more space to store data. So in this case you might write:
PHP код:
for(new i = 0, j = cache_get_row_count(); i < j && i < MAX_BUILDINGS; i ++)